Suppose our design calls for a +/-10 V triangle wave, cruising along at 10 kHz. This means that Vth+ = +10 V and Vth- = -10 V. Given VP = +5 V, VN = -5 V, let's choose R2 = 10 k Ω and then calculate R1 = 20 k Ω from the equation above.

WebMay 22, 2024 · The basic operation of an integrator is shown in Figure 10.2.1. The output voltage is the result of the definite integral of Vin from time = 0 to some arbitrary time t. Added to this will be a constant that represents the output of the network at t = 0. Remember, integration is basically the process of summation.
